Output 95fd66744a6e9503159b47df2f09117c8eefaacb93cfc82bb0f6754d05655605:12

value
122200000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f5e7e6c85ad5a57c4c13af42d2dec022e517c5bd OP_EQUALVERIFY OP_CHECKSIG
address
LheBd1XCDT8xtrbgmUAe4wq63cE9mLrAx2
transaction
95fd66744a6e9503159b47df2f09117c8eefaacb93cfc82bb0f6754d05655605
spent
true